This is a slight adaptation of a recipe in Cool Camping
Sausage and pasta
Serves 4
Ingredients
6-8 sausages - whatever kind you prefer, but preferably strong flavoured ones (**)
2 onions
6 cloves garlic(*)
1 1/2 teaspoon chilli powder (*)
2 cartons tomatoes in tomato puree (*)
1/2 bottle red wine (*)
Handful fresh oregano
Half handful fresh basil (*)
Half handful sage leaves (*)
Olive oil for cooking
500g pasta
Heat oil in a frying pan and a saute pan or chef's pan or similar
In frying pan, add sausages and start cooking over a medium heat
In other pan, fry onions, then garlic. Add chilli now if using fresh
When sausages are nicely brown and onions are soft add chilli powder, shredded herbs and 1/2 red wine to onions.
Chop sausages into 4 and add to onion mix.
Stir and cook for about 5 mins
Add tomatoes and remainder of wine.
Simmer for 20-30 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Whilst that is simmering, boil water for pasta
When water is boiling, put in salt, bring back to boil and add pasta
Cook according to instructions
When pasta cooked, strain and add to sausages.
Stir and serve
(* Recipe called for 1 glass of white wine, no basil and sage, and tinned tomatoes or passata. It also called for only 2 cloves of garlic, and suggested one fresh chilli. If I'd've used fresh chillis, I would have used about 6 small medium heat ones. I changed to red wine for two reasons - it goes better with tomatoes and the sausages I used, plus we didn't have any white...)
